Mysql
 sql >> Database >  >> RDS >> Mysql

Configura MySQL 5.6 con Macports

MacPorts installa MySQL ei suoi derivati ​​in modo che non siano in conflitto tra loro e possano essere installati contemporaneamente. Ciò include l'inserimento del binario mysql in percorsi non standard. Puoi individuare il tuo binario usando port contents mysql56 | grep -E '/s?bin/' . MacPorts include anche un meccanismo di selezione che crea collegamenti simbolici per la tua comodità in /opt/local/bin . Per impostare MySQL 5.6 come predefinito, esegui sudo port select --set mysql mysql56 .

Per avviare il server, puoi utilizzare le funzioni di controllo del demone di MacPorts (che sono un frontend da avviare):sudo port load mysql56-server avvierà il server e si assicurerà che sia in esecuzione dopo un riavvio, sudo port unload mysql56-server lo annullerà e arresterà il server.

Il --skip-networking è l'impostazione predefinita per rendere possibile l'esecuzione affiancata di più versioni di MySQL. Vedi port notes mysql56 per ulteriori informazioni.

Puoi connetterti a MySQL di MacPorts usando un socket unix, anche se non ricordo il suo percorso dalla cima della mia testa. Sono sicuro che http://trac.macports.org/wiki/howto/MAMP li ha, però. Per connetterti al tuo server locale, dovresti usare localhost o 127.0.0.1 invece di bp.local , che apparentemente si risolve in un indirizzo IP privato e quindi passa attraverso lo stack IP del tuo sistema operativo, piuttosto che attraverso l'interfaccia di loopback.